Braves acquire pitcher Martin from Rangers

The Atlanta Braves acquired right-handed reliever Chris Martin from the Texas Rangers in exchange for minor league left-hander Kolby Allard, both teams confirmed Tuesday evening.Martin, 33, is 0-2 with a 3.08 ERA and four saves in 38 innings out of the bullpen this season, striking out 43 and walking only four. He returned to the majors in 2018 with Texas after pitching two years in Japan. He played with Colorado in 2014 and the New York Yankees in 2015.Martin signed a two-year, $4 million deal with the Rangers in 2017 and is a free agent at season's end.Allard, the No. 14 pick by the Braves in the 2015 draft, is Atlanta's 10th-ranked prospect, according to MLB Pipeline. The 21-year-old is 7-5 with a 4.17 ERA in 20 starts for Triple-A Gwinnett this season. The Rangers announced Allard will report to Triple-A Nashville.Allard was considered a top 100 prospect in all of baseball before last season, when he posted a 2.96 ERA in 19 starts with Gwinnett. He made his major league debut with the Braves in July and struggled, allowing 12 runs (11 earned) on 19 hits in eight innings with Atlanta across three games (one start).--Field Level Media
